Job Summary

The Digital Marketing Manager - Performance & Operations is responsible for planning, executing, analysing, and optimising all digital marketing activity across the Group's retail dealership network and brands.

This role combines performance marketing ownership with marketing workflow coordination, ensuring that all campaigns are data-driven, measurable, and efficiently executed across internal teams, agencies, and OEM partners.

The primary objective of the role is to transform marketing into a revenue-driven function by improving lead quality, increasing conversion rates, and maximising return on marketing investment through continuous optimisation and data analysis. As the internal marketing function evolves, this role will increasingly serve as the central marketing operations and coordination function.

Key Responsibilities

Performance Marketing & Campaign Optimisation
  • Plan, launch, manage, and optimise paid digital campaigns across platforms (Google, Meta, programmatic, etc.)
  • Allocate budgets strategically based on performance, inventory priorities, and sales targets
  • Continuously optimise campaigns to improve cost per lead, conversion rates, and ROI
  • Conduct A/B testing across ads, audiences, and landing pages
  • Adjust campaigns dynamically using live performance data
  • Creating quarterly marketing plans for management sign off
Lead Intelligence & Revenue Analysis
  • Analyse leads across platforms, CRM systems, and dealer data
  • Track lead to sale conversion by source, brand, region, and campaign
  • Identify high quality vs low quality lead sources and optimise spend accordingly
  • Work closely with sales teams to gather feedback on lead quality
  • Improve funnel performance from click lead appointment sale
Tracking, Attribution & Reporting
  • Ensure accurate tracking and tagging across all digital campaigns
  • Implement and maintain attribution models
  • Monitor campaign performance daily
  • Produce weekly and monthly performance reports
  • Build dashboards showing real time performance insights
  • Identify underperforming channels early and recommend corrective action
Agency & Vendor Performance Management
  • Manage digital agency relationships and performance standards
  • Review media strategies and optimisation approaches
  • Ensure agency recommendations are data driven and commercially aligned
  • Ensure campaigns launch correctly, track accurately, and deliver measurable results
Marketing Workflow Coordination (Scalable Function)
  • Act as the central intake point for marketing briefs from internal stakeholders
  • Translate business objectives into structured briefs for creative and media teams
  • Route projects to the appropriate internal or external resources
  • Prioritise work based on urgency, impact, and commercial value
  • Coordinate timelines to ensure campaigns launch on schedule
  • Maintain visibility across all active campaigns
  • Identify workflow bottlenecks and implement process improvements

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

Performance Impact
  • Development of full sales funnel conversion metrics specific to marketing leads
  • Cost per Lead (CPL) improvement
  • Return on Ad Spend (ROAS) or GP ROAS
  • Lead to Sale Conversion Rate
  • Marketing Attributed Revenue Growth
Efficiency & Optimisation
  • Time to optimise underperforming campaigns
  • % of spend allocated to top performing channels
  • Reduction in wasted ad spend
Lead Quality
  • Qualified lead rate
  • Sales team feedback on lead qualityConversion performance by channel vs benchmark
Operational Coordination
  • Brief to launch turnaround time
  • % of campaigns delivered on schedule
  • Stakeholder satisfaction score
  • Brief completeness score
